Statement of Significance

What is significant?
The house, constructed c.1925 in the California bungalow style, at 634 Bell Street, Preston. The original form, external materials and detailing, and siting of the house contribute to its significance.

Later alterations and additions and the front fence are not significant.

How is it significant?
The house at 634 Bell Street, Preston is of local architectural significance to Darebin City.

Why is it significant?
It is architecturally significant as a fine example of a inter-war bungalow, with a dominant roof form and detailing that is typical of the style. The detailing to the gable ends and windows is especially notable. (Criterion D)
